在autodl算力云上部署Stable Diffusion:高效计算与图像生成

作者:新兰2023.09.27 11:37浏览量:19

简介:在autodl算力云上部署Stable Diffusion

在autodl算力云上部署Stable Diffusion
引言
随着人工智能和深度学习领域的快速发展,算力成为了制约模型训练和应用的重要因素。而Stable Diffusion作为一种强大的深度学习模型,其应用场景越来越广泛,但同样需要大量的算力支持。针对这一问题,本文将介绍如何在autodl算力云上部署Stable Diffusion,以实现更高效、更便捷的模型训练和应用。
算力云介绍
autodl算力云是一种基于云计算的平台,为用户提供灵活、高效的算力资源。它支持多种深度学习框架,包括TensorFlowPyTorch等,并提供了可视化界面,方便用户根据自己的需求定制训练任务和参数。同时,autodl算力云还具有以下优势:

  1. 高可用性:提供了多种算力资源,包括CPU、GPU等,能够满足不同用户的需求。
  2. 灵活性:用户可根据需要随时调整算力资源,支持多种作业调度策略,满足不同场景下的训练需求。
  3. 易用性:提供了简单易用的API接口和可视化界面,使得用户可以方便地管理和监控训练任务。
    Stable Diffusion介绍
    Stable Diffusion是一种基于扩散过程的深度学习模型,它能够在较短的时间内对大规模数据进行有效的处理。其主要应用场景包括图像生成、文本生成等,具有以下优势:
  4. 速度快:Stable Diffusion能够在短时间内处理大量数据,使得其在实时应用中具有很大的优势。
  5. 效果好:通过学习和扩散过程,Stable Diffusion能够生成高质量的图像和文本等结果。
    在autodl算力云上部署Stable Diffusion
    在autodl算力云上部署Stable Diffusion需要经过以下步骤:
  6. 前期准备:首先需要准备一台具备较强计算能力的服务器或工作站,并安装autodl算力云平台的相关软件和工具。
  7. 创建算力资源:在autodl算力云平台上,根据需求创建所需的算力资源,如CPU、GPU等,并配置相关参数。
  8. 部署Stable Diffusion模型:将Stable Diffusion模型及其依赖库上传至autodl算力云平台,并使用平台提供的工具进行编译和部署。同时,根据实际需求配置模型参数。
  9. 启动训练任务:通过autodl算力云平台提供的可视化界面或API接口,启动Stable Diffusion模型的训练任务。根据实际情况配置训练参数,如批量大小、迭代次数等。
  10. 监控和维护:在训练过程中,可以通过autodl算力云平台对训练任务进行实时监控,以便及时发现问题并进行调整。同时,定期对模型进行优化和调整,以提高训练效果和稳定性。
    应用案例
    假设某公司需要在新产品推广期间快速生成大量高质量的宣传图片,以供广告和宣传活动使用。通过在autodl算力云上部署Stable Diffusion模型,该公司可以轻松实现以下目标:
  11. 提高效率:Stable Diffusion能够在短时间内处理大量数据,并生成高质量的图像结果,大大缩短了传统图像生成所需的时间和人力。
  12. 降低成本:通过使用autodl算力云平台的按需付费模式,该公司只需支付所需的算力资源费用,无需投入大量资金购买和维护高性能计算设备。